文摘
•
Previous studies have observed reduced heart rate variability (HRV) in depression.
•
The effects of major depression and antidepressants on HRV were measured.
•
Unmedicated patients with major depression displayed lower HRV than controls.
•
Depression severity independently contributed to decreased HRV and vagal tone.
•
Compared with paroxetine, agomelatine had a more vagotonic effect.
